About STPS30M60ST

STPS30M60ST is a Schottky Diode with Dual Anode component manufactured by STMicroelectronics. It comes in a Transistor Outline, Vertical package. Below you'll find known alternative and equivalent parts that can serve as replacements in your design.

Why Look for Alternatives?

Finding alternatives for STPS30M60ST is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.
